President
Head of State and National Government, elected by voters of the Republic of Kenya.

Roles and responsibilities
- Head of State and National Government
- Commander-in-Chief of the Kenya Defence Forces
- Chairperson of the National Security Council
- Symbol of national unity
- Safeguards the sovereignty of the Republic
- Promotes national unity and respect for diversity
- Ensures protection of human rights, fundamental freedoms and the rule of law
- Chairs Cabinet meetings
Qualifications overview
- Kenyan citizen by birth
- Registered voter
- Qualified for election as a Member of Parliament
- Degree from a university recognized in Kenya
- Nominated by a political party or an independent candidate
- Must meet applicable moral, ethical and legal requirements
Constitution references: Articles 129–132, Articles 137–138
